Re: After linking EPIC games and EA app game will not launch

@kakeguruialex  Please do a clean uninstall and reinstall of Sims 4 with Revo Uninstaller:

  • Put aside your Sims 4 folder in Documents\Electronic Arts and rename it to something that doesn't include the words "Sims 4."
  • Download Revo Uninstaller (the free version is fine) from here.
  • Launch Revo, select Sims 4 from the list, and click Uninstall.
  • Once the game is uninstalled, select "Moderate" under "scanning modes," and click Scan.
  • Review the list, in case there's something you want to save; otherwise, click Select All, and then Delete.
  • Close Revo, and restart your computer.

It's worth using Revo to uninstall and reinstall the EA App as well.  Then reinstall the App, restart your computer, and reinstall Sims 4 through the app of your choice.  If you install through the EA App, you may need to launch the game through Epic once; there's a thread about this issue here:

https://answers.ea.com/t5/Bug-Reports-Technical-Issues/Sims-launching-through-Epic-instead-of-EA-app/m-p/12547957#M27250

After that, it looks like you should be able to use the EA App without Epic.

    @Silasthewarrior0  If you haven't restored the Sims 4 folder that was previously in Documents > Electronic Arts (and that you renamed), then your saves wouldn't show up in-game.  But the saves and everything else should still be intact in that folder.

    The only reasons your saves would have been permanently deleted are if you didn't do that first step of moving and renaming the Sims 4 folder or if you accidentally deleted it some other way.
